Top 5 Best 48134 Michigan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 9 public schools serving 3,579 students in 48134, MI.
The top ranked public schools in 48134, MI are Wegienka Elementary School, Flat Rock Academic Virtual K5 and Maple Grove Alternative High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 48134 have an average math proficiency score of 33% (versus the Michigan public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 44% (versus the 46% statewide average). Schools in 48134, MI have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Michigan public schools.
Minority enrollment is 28%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is less than the Michigan public school average of 37% (majority Black).
